Located in the Canyons District at 217 East 7800 South in Midvale, UT, Midvalley School serves grades K-6 and has an enrollment of roughly 596 students. Frequently Asked Questions about Midvale
How much are Studio apartments in Midvale?
There are currently 45 Studio Apartments in Midvale with rent ranges from $989 to $2,537 with an average price of $1,235.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Midvale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Midvale ranges from $949 to $2,866 with an average monthly rent of $1,345.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Midvale c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Midvale range from $1,100 to $3,639.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,706.
How expensive are Midvale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 72 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Midvale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,545 to $3,990 - averaging $2,420 for the location.
